Human–AI Ecosystems & SheLL
Instead of treating models as isolated tools, we view AI as part of a larger ecosystem of humans and agents that learn from each other over time.
In this vertical, we explore:
- SheLL (Shared Experience Lifelong Learning) – frameworks for sharing knowledge and experience across institutions, agents, and tasks.
- Multi-agent collaboration – how AI systems and humans can coordinate, specialize, and exchange information.
- Autonomous research assistants – algorithmic foundations for agents that can help design studies, run experiments, and iterate on ideas.
These projects aim to move from single-model training toward continuous, collective intelligence that accelerates scientific discovery.
